Tasteless
Webster's Dictionary
(1):
(a.) Destitute of the sense of taste; or of good taste; as, a tasteless age.
(2):
(a.) Not in accordance with good taste; as, a tasteless arrangement of drapery.
(3):
(a.) Having no taste; insipid; flat; as, tasteless fruit.
